Originally premiering November 25th, 1998, "Nerds 2.0.1: A Brief History of the Internet" stars Steve Jobs, Bill Gates, Scott McNealy, Bob Cringely. The series runs 1 season(s), and has a score of 60 (out of 100) on TMDB, which collated reviews from 4 top people.

Interested in knowing what the series is about? Here’s the plot: "Nerds 2.0.1: A Brief History of the Internet is a 1998 three hour American PBS documentary film that explores the development of the Arpanet, the Internet, and the World Wide Web in the United States from 1969 to 1998. It was created during the dot-com boom of the late 1990s. The documentary was written and hosted by Robert X. Cringely and is the sequel to the 1996 documentary, Triumph of the Nerds. "
